summ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rwxr-xr-xredis/client.py2
1 files changed, 2 insertions, 0 deletions
diff --git a/redis/client.py b/redis/client.py
index ae4fae2..16ffbb0 100755
--- a/redis/client.py
+++ b/redis/client.py
@@ -1530,6 +1530,8 @@ class PubSub:
with a message handler, the handler is invoked instead of a parsed
message being returned.
"""
+ if response is None:
+ return None
message_type = str_if_bytes(response[0])
if message_type == "pmessage":
message = {